Voir le sujet précédent :: Voir le sujet suivant |
Auteur |
Message |
BookBookG4 PowerBook d'Albâtre
Inscrit le: 15 Juin 2005 Messages: 798
|
Posté le: Jeu 03 Aoû 2006 à 22:58 Sujet du message: Commande autos dans terminal ?? |
|
|
Bonsoir, je voudrai savoir si je pouvais créer une commande automatique dans le terminal?
"Telnet 192.168.1.1"
"Login : admin"
"Password : 1234"
"Restart"
"Exit"
"Exit"
Est ce que c'est possible de le faire intérpréter sa sans à avoir taper a chaque fois les commandes ?? Merci |
|
Revenir en haut de page |
|
|
tintamarre PowerBook de Chêne
Inscrit le: 07 Mai 2004 Messages: 938 Localisation: Houte-Si-Plou
|
Posté le: Ven 04 Aoû 2006 à 0:01 Sujet du message: |
|
|
Oui, oui. Tu crée un Bash-Script et c'est bon
emacs script.bash (ou nano si tu préfères)
#!/bin/bash
tes/ta commande(s)
exit
Tu lui donnes des permissions chmod 755 script.bash
Et enfin pour l'éxécuter tu fais sudo ./script.bash _________________ Martin
MacBook Pro i5 2,6 GHz 8 Go 256 Go SSD
MacBook Unibody 2,4 GHz 4 Go 120 Go SSD NVidia
Wp ++ - http://fr.wikipedia.org
|
|
Revenir en haut de page |
|
|
BookBookG4 PowerBook d'Albâtre
Inscrit le: 15 Juin 2005 Messages: 798
|
Posté le: Ven 04 Aoû 2006 à 1:05 Sujet du message: |
|
|
oula oula je suis pas fortiche avec le language mac...
moi je voudrai simplement que cette commande se fasse toute seule :
mais j'ai pas saisi l'histoire du script.bash, enfin de l'option |
|
Revenir en haut de page |
|
|
kenji PowerBook de Laine
Inscrit le: 06 Mar 2005 Messages: 73
|
Posté le: Sam 05 Aoû 2006 à 9:35 Sujet du message: |
|
|
tu veux faire redémarrer quoi ?
Parce que perso, je ferai une tache cron sur la machine distante. ça se fait beaucoup se genre de chose, tu peut lancer une commande (ou un script) tous les X minutes ou heures ou jour.
Comme ça t'évite même de lancer ton script. (enfin si c'est ce que tu veux).
Si c'est pour le redémarrer une fois de temps en temps, tu devra tapé les commandes, car on ne peut pas laisser le mot de passe dans le script.
Par contre tu peux faire un "telnet -l utilisateur 192.168.1.1". Et après ça te demande ton pass.
Un autre truc, il existe des alias de commande (genre alias telnetMoi='telnet -...'
|
|
Revenir en haut de page |
|
|
|